Best National Parks Near Los Altos Hills, CA

Pinnacles National Park, located in California, is known for its stunning rock formations and diverse wildlife. The park offers various camping options, including RV camping at the Pinnacles Campground. No hookups are available, so come prepared with a fully self-contained RV. Enjoy hiking trails and the chance to spot rare bird species like the California condor.Yosemite National Park, located in the Sierra Nevada, offers iconic natural wonders such as granite cliffs and cascading waterfalls. The park has 13 campgrounds that accommodate both RVs and tents. Some campgrounds are seasonal, so plan accordingly. Explore extensive hiking trails, marvel at towering waterfalls, and watch for wildlife like black bears.Lassen Volcanic National Park provides a unique opportunity to experience volcanic landscapes. RV camping is available at Manzanita Lake Campground, with stunning views of the surrounding mountains. Explore over 150 miles of trails and hydrothermal areas showcasing volcanic activity, and enjoy stargazing in this designated Dark Sky Park.Kings Canyon National Park in the Sierra Nevada offers giant sequoias, deep canyons, and breathtaking views. Stay overnight in campgrounds offering tent and RV options. Enjoy outdoor activities like hiking and horseback riding, explore scenic drives, and venture into the backcountry for backpacking trips.Some locations listed in this article are the nearest of their kind to the starting point, and the actual drivable distance could exceed 200 miles.

Popular State Parks Near Los Altos Hills, CA

Portola Redwoods State Park: Immerse yourself in the majestic beauty of Portola Redwoods State Park. Explore the towering redwood trees that dominate the landscape and enjoy various recreational activities such as hiking and wildlife watching. With 55 family campsites available, you can experience modern amenities surrounded by nature's tranquility.Big Basin Redwoods: Discover the awe-inspiring beauty of Big Basin Redwoods. Marvel at the towering redwoods and embark on scenic hikes along the park's extensive trail network. Camping options are available for both tent campers and RVers, allowing you to sleep under the canopy of trees.Half Moon Bay State Park: Experience the beauty of Half Moon Bay State Park, located on the coast just south of San Francisco. Enjoy sandy beaches, rugged cliffs, and various outdoor activities, including hiking, picnicking, and fishing. Henry Cowell Redwoods: Visit Henry Cowell Redwoods State Park and be enchanted by the majestic redwood grove. Take leisurely walks or challenge yourself with more strenuous hikes through this ancient forest. The park also offers camping opportunities for RVers to immerse themselves in nature's tranquility.

National Forests Near Los Altos Hills, CA

Eldorado National Forest: Embark on an unforgettable outdoor adventure at Eldorado National Forest, located in California. This forest offers ample opportunities for hiking, fishing, and wildlife viewing. With its diverse landscapes of forests, lakes, and mountains, you'll be immersed in the beauty of nature. Choose from numerous campgrounds like Ice House Campground, offering RV sites with picnic tables and fire rings. Watch for black bears, mountain lions, and bald eagles as you explore the trails or rock climb at Lover's Leap.Stanislaus National Forest: Discover breathtaking views and recreational activities at Stanislaus National Forest. This forest boasts mountains, meadows, lakes, rivers, and dense forests. Hike along trails suitable for all skill levels, and try fishing in pristine lakes and rivers. Don't miss the stunning Clavey Falls or Columns of the Giants. During winter months, enjoy snowshoeing and skiing activities.Mendocino National Forest: Head to Mendocino National Forest for a great RV adventure! Encompassing over 900,000 acres in California with rugged mountains and lush forests. Campgrounds like Pogie Point or Fouts Springs offer amenities such as picnic tables and toilets. Enjoy hiking or fishing on scenic trails like Burris Basin or Bear Wallow Trail.

RVshare’s Top Picks for Nearby RV Parks & Campgrounds

Trailer Villa RV Park: This RV campground in Los Altos Hills, California, offers 116 sites with full hookups for 30/50 Amp. You'll find back-in and pull-through sites available. There are showers and Wi-Fi on-site, as well as laundry facilities. Pets are allowed for a fee.

How do I properly navigate and park a Class A motorhome rental in urban areas or tight spaces in Los Altos Hills, CA?

Class A motorhomes can be large and require a bit of practice and patience to navigate and park in tight spaces. When driving in urban areas, it's important to be aware of your surroundings and plan your route ahead of time to avoid narrow streets, low overpasses, or weight restrictions. When parking, look for spacious lots that allow for easy entry and exit. It may also be helpful to have a spotter help guide you into your parking spot.

What fuel efficiency considerations do I need to consider when operating a Class A motorhome rental, and how can I minimize the impact on my fuel costs?

Class A motorhomes typically have lower fuel efficiency due to their size and weight. However, there are ways to minimize fuel costs such as driving at a steady speed and avoiding abrupt stops and starts.

Are any unique features or amenities available in Class A motorhome rentals that may not be found in other RVs in Los Altos Hills, CA?

Class A motorhomes often feature high-end amenities such as leather seating, residential-sized kitchens, and luxurious bedding. Some may also feature high-tech entertainment systems or outdoor kitchens. It's best to check with your RV owner for any specific unique features or amenities that may be available in your rental.
